Bir zamanlar, web hosting dünyasında kontrol paneli kullanmak, sadece teknik bilgilere sahip olanların ulaşabileceği bir ayrıcalık gibi görünürdü. Ancak, günümüzde cPanel gibi araçlar, herkesin web sitelerini yönetmesini kolaylaştırıyor. Bu yazımızda, Ubuntu üzerinde cPanel kurulumunun nasıl yapıldığını adım adım anlatacağım. Hazırsanız, hemen başlayalım!
cPanel Nedir?
Peki, Ubuntu sunucusunda cPanel nasıl kurulur? Haydi, bunu birlikte keşfedelim.
1. Adım: Sunucunuzu Hazırlayın
İlk olarak, sunucunuza SSH ile bağlanarak root kullanıcısı olarak giriş yapın:
```bash
ssh root@sunucu_ip_adresi
```
Eğer henüz bir VPS veya dedicated sunucu satın almadıysanız, bir sağlayıcıdan (DigitalOcean, Vultr, AWS vb.) bir Ubuntu sunucu kiralayabilirsiniz.
2. Adım: Sisteminizi Güncelleyin
```bash
apt update && apt upgrade -y
```
Bu işlem, sistemdeki tüm eski yazılımların güncellenmesini sağlar ve cPanel kurulumu sırasında sorun yaşamamanıza yardımcı olur.
3. Adım: cPanel & WHM Kurulum Dosyasını İndirin
```bash
cd /home && curl -o latest -L https://securedownloads.cpanel.net/latest
```
Bu komut, cPanel’in en son sürümünü sunucunuza indirecek.
4. Adım: Kurulumu Başlatın
```bash
sh latest
```
Bu işlem birkaç dakika sürecektir. Kurulum sırasında, terminalde bazı loglar görmeye başlayacaksınız. Sabırlı olun, kurulum tamamlandığında cPanel, sunucunuzda çalışmaya hazır olacaktır.
5. Adım: Kurulum Tamamlandıktan Sonra Yapılandırma
```
https://sunucu_ip_adresi:2087
```
WHM giriş ekranı karşınıza çıkacaktır. Buradan root kullanıcısı ve şifrenizle giriş yaparak, cPanel’in yapılandırma işlemlerine başlayabilirsiniz.
İpucu: cPanel, yalnızca belirli bir IP adresine kurulabilir. Bu nedenle, WHM’ye erişmek için kullandığınız IP adresi, sunucunuzun IP adresiyle eşleşmelidir.
6. Adım: cPanel’e Erişim ve Başlangıç Ayarları
WHM üzerinden temel yapılandırma ayarlarını yaptıktan sonra, cPanel’e giriş yapmak için şu URL’yi kullanabilirsiniz:
```
https://sunucu_ip_adresi:2083
```
Buradan, web sitenizle ilgili tüm yönetim işlemlerini rahatlıkla yapabilirsiniz.
7. Adım: Lisans Aktivasyonu
Lisansı aktifleştirmek için, WHM arayüzünde "Server Configuration" > "Licensing" kısmına gidin ve lisans anahtarınızı girin.
Sonuç
cPanel’in sağladığı bu rahatlık ve kullanım kolaylığı, hosting yönetiminizi çok daha profesyonel hale getirecektir. Her adımda yaşadığınız zorlukları aşarak, Ubuntu üzerinde cPanel’i kurmayı başardığınızda, sisteminizin ne kadar güçlü ve kullanıcı dostu olduğunu bir kez daha göreceksiniz.